We present the development of novel electrochemical supercapacitor and sensor based on silver (Ag) nanoparticles coated graphene oxide (GO). 10-20 nm diameter of Ag nanoparticles were well dispersed on the surface of graphene oxide through the chemical reduction method. Ag-coated GO nanohybrids were characterized by transmission electron microscopy (TEM), X-ray diffraction, Raman spectroscopy, electrical and an electrochemical analysis for the energy storage (supercapacitors), energy conversion (solar cells) and sensor applications. It is found that nanohybrid electrodes showed good specific capacitance and electrochemical sensing performance in comparison to pristine GO. The improvement in the electrochemical characteristics can be attributed to the sensitizing effect between Ag nanparticles and GO. These GO/Ag hybrid transparent conducting films also show low resistance and good transmittance, suggesting they are good electrodes for the opto-electronic devices (e.g. solar cells).
